Windsurfers are currently the fastest sailing craft holding the world speed record at an incredible 49.09 Knots (56.49mph or 90.91kph) See below for video of Antione Albeau setting the current world record in spring 2008. Windsurfers have always liked going fast,regardless of if it's on your own or blasting along with friends we all like to feel the excitement of going fast. Most recreational windsurfers will be doing 20 - 25 knots (23-28mph) most of the time
With advances in modern technology you can now find out how fast your going with a small GPS unit, this has lead to many windsurfers recording their speeds and posting them online. Leading the way with this is the GPS-Speedsurfing website which allows anyone to upload there gps data and see it ranked againsit other users all over the world. More at: http://www.gps-speedsurfing.com In the UK we also have the Weymouth speedweek every October and a last year saw the start of a new event called Driven By Wind which is aiming to break the 50 Knot barrier in the UK at the Ray near Southend.
